Subject: RE: Accident Report From: Skipper Jack Date: 07 Jul 02 - 10:05 AM "The Accident Report" is not related in any way to The Sick Note/Bricklayer Letter. I believe the title of the piece is "Don't Panic! Write a Report." It is a letter written by the master of a vessel after a series of accidents when it entering harbour, which occur through a simple misunderstanding. He is writing to the vessels owners explaining the sequence of events.
